OBSERVATIONS AND CORRECTIVE ACTIONS
Item
Number
Violations cited in this report must be corrected within the time frames below.
8 Violation of Code: [46.825(a)] A cap is missing from the garbage grinder which has created a leak so bad that the prep area hand/ grinder sink is not usable. The cap was replaced, but now the sink won't drain. New Violation.
8 Violation of Code: [46.941(a)-(e)] Soap was not provided at the prep area hand sink. Soap was later provided. Repeat Violation.
35 Violation of Code: [46.282] Working bulk food ingredient storage containers are not labeled with the common name of the food. New Violation.
36 Violation of Code: [46.981(k)(l)] -Mouse droppings were observed in the food prep area. Repeat Violation.
41 Violation of Code: [46.302] Common bowls or food containers observed without handles in direct contact with bulk food ingredients. New Violation.
45 Violation of Code: [46.652] The prep area hand sink is not sealed to the wall. New Violation.
49 Violation of Code: [46.822] Hot water is not provided at the mop sink. Repeat Violation.
49 Violation of Code: [46.825(b)-(e)] The food prep sink and three basin sink drains leak. New Violation.
53 Violation of Code: [46.921] -Food prep area ceiling tiles are not smooth and easily cleanable. Repeat Violation.
53 Violation of Code: [46.981(a)(b)(c)(g)(n)] Mouse droppings were observed along prep area floor perimeters. Repeat Violation.

Summary
Statements
Due to conditions observed during the inspection, the establishment has agreed to discontinue food operations and voluntarily close until it is approved by the Department to resume operations.
